Behind the query "ISO 27001 courses" sit at least three different needs: understanding the requirements before a project starts, preparing your own internal auditors, or proving an individual's qualification. The programmes that serve those needs are different, and confusing them costs money and time. Here is what a certification body offers, who benefits from each option, and where the line runs that we do not cross.

Three requests under one name

What is actually needed For whom Format
Understand the requirements before building a system management, process owners overview programme, 1 day
Teach people to audit their own system future internal auditors in-depth programme with practice, 2-3 days
Prove an individual qualification with a document specialists building a career in the field personnel certification scheme, separate providers

The first two needs are served by a certification body. The third works differently — more on it below.

ISO 27001 training from the body: what the programme covers

The sessions are built around the text of the current 2022 edition and cover five blocks:

  • The structure of the requirements. Clauses 4 to 10 and what changed compared with the 2013 edition.
  • Annex A. An overview of the 93 controls in four themes, the principles of selection, and how the choice is justified in the Statement of Applicability.
  • Risk assessment. Methods for identifying threats and weaknesses, and building a treatment plan.
  • Incident management. Classification, response, investigation, root cause analysis.
  • Preparing for the audit. How the process works, typical nonconformities, what the audit team expects.

Duration runs from one to three days depending on the programme. The format is your choice: a webinar, or classroom sessions at our centre or on your premises. Sessions are delivered in Ukrainian; English on request. Every participant receives materials and a record of attendance.

The impartiality boundary

Imperium Certific training programmes are strictly educational and are organisationally separated from the certification process. The sessions do not involve developing documentation, implementing systems, or consulting on management systems for specific organisations. Attending a programme does not influence the certification decision and creates no advantage during an audit.

The rule comes not from internal policy but from ISO/IEC 17021-1. Generic teaching — explaining requirements, audit methods and typical approaches — is not considered consultancy. Designing a client's system, on the other hand, is, and the consequence is strict: an organisation that received such help from a party related to the body cannot be certified by that body for two years.

IT audit of ISO 27001 and security audit: what people mean

Four distinct things:

  • An internal audit of the system. Carried out by the company itself, using trained employees or an external specialist. Required by clause 9; without it certification is impossible.
  • The certification audit. Carried out by an accredited body; the result is a certificate.
  • A gap analysis. Comparing the current state against the requirements before a project starts. This is consultancy work, which is precisely why a body does not do it for organisations it will later audit.
  • A technical security assessment. Scanning, penetration testing, configuration review. It produces technical findings but does not confirm that the system conforms.

A record of attendance versus personnel certification

At the end of the sessions, participants receive a record of attendance. It confirms participation and the material covered — an honest and useful document for internal HR records.

A qualification certificate is a different matter. It is issued under a personnel certification scheme operating to ISO/IEC 17024: an examination, verified experience, periodic reconfirmation of competence. Bodies accredited to 17021-1 work with the systems of organisations, not with the qualifications of individuals, so they do not issue such documents.
